China has sparked controversy once more by revealing a list of thirty new names for different locations in the northeastern Indian state of Arunachal Pradesh and renaming it to ‘Zangnan’ . India has firmly opposed this measure, which is intended to assert territorial claims.

China Renames Places in Arunachal Pradesh

The list of renamed locations, which includes residential neighbourhoods, rivers, and mountains, was made public by the Ministry of Civil Affairs of China. China has made previous attempts to rename locations within Indian territory.

India’s Reaction

: Promptly rejecting China’s claims, India’s Ministry of External Affairs affirmed that Arunachal Pradesh is an essential component of India. China’s assertions, according to External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ar, are “ludicrous” and Arunachal’s position as an Indian state remains unchanged despite name changes.

Diplomatic Standoff

The two nations’ long-standing border issues have gotten worse as a result of China renaming certain locations. India has taken measures to protect its territory by sustaining a robust military presence along the Line of Actual Control (LAC).

In conclusion, the renaming of locations in Arunachal by China is perceived as a provocative move meant to undermine India’s sovereignty. But India is not changing its position; it still maintains that Arunachal Pradesh is an essential component of India. In order to settle border conflicts and preserve regional peace while tensions remain, diplomatic measures will be essential.
